S T A T E O F N E W Y O R K ________________________________________________________________________ S. 4599 A. 6663 2015-2016 Regular Sessions S E N A T E - A S S E M B L Y March 30, 2015 ___________ IN SENATE -- Introduced by Sen. BRESLIN -- read twice and ordered print- ed, and when printed to be committed to the Committee on Insurance IN ASSEMBLY -- Introduced by M. of A. McDONALD -- read once and referred to the Committee on Insurance AN ACT to amend the insurance law, in relation to authorizing the super- intendent of financial services to suspend crediting of underwriting earnings for a fiscal year for the purposes of accumulating a subscriber's operating reserve TH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. Paragraph 3 of subsection a of section 6109 of the insur- ance law, as amended by chapter 138 of the laws of 1987, is amended to read as follows: (3) Notwithstanding the foregoing, the superintendent may, upon appli- cation from the attorney-in-fact, approve other methods for accumulating such subscriber's operating reserve, INCLUDING FOR MUNICIPAL RECIPROCAL INSURERS, THE SUSPENSION OF CREDITING OF UNDERWRITING EARNINGS FOR A FISCAL YEAR SO LONG AS THOSE SAME AMOUNTS ARE RETURNED DIRECTLY TO MUNICIPAL SUBSCRIBERS IN THE YEAR IMMEDIATELY FOLLOWING THE FISCAL YEAR FOR WHICH SAID UNDERWRITING EARNINGS WERE GENERATED AND FOR WHICH SUSPENSION OF FUNDING OF THE OPERATING RESERVE WAS AUTHORIZED BY THE SUPERINTENDENT. S 2. This act shall take effect immediately. EXPLANATION--Matter in ITALICS (underscored) is new; matter in brackets [ ] is old law to be omitted. LBD10161-01-5
